Byrasandra Population - Kolar, Karnataka

Byrasandra is a small village located in Kolar Taluka of Kolar district, Karnataka with total 33 families residing. The Byrasandra village has population of 153 of which 68 are males while 85 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Byrasandra village population of children with age 0-6 is 9 which makes up 5.88 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Byrasandra village is 1250 which is higher than Karnataka state average of 973. Child Sex Ratio for the Byrasandra as per census is 0, lower than Karnataka average of 948.

Byrasandra village has lower literacy rate compared to Karnataka. In 2011, literacy rate of Byrasandra village was 63.19 % compared to 75.36 % of Karnataka. In Byrasandra Male literacy stands at 73.53 % while female literacy rate was 53.95 %.

Caste Factor

In Byrasandra village, most of the villagers are from Schedule Caste (SC).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 41.83 % of total population in Byrasandra village. The village Byrasandra curr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Byrasandra village out of total population, 67 were engaged in work activities. 95.52 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 4.48 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 67 workers engaged in Main Work, 18 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 5 were Agricultural labourer.
